Make no mistake about it, when Nick Saban steps to the podium under the glare of SEC Media Days on Friday, the mercurial Alabama head football coach will be barraged with questions and comments about how talented his 2011 Crimson Tide football team is. He will unsuccessfully try to downplay expectations, reminding media of the unsettled quarterback position and the loss of the team's best wide receiver, running back and defensive lineman, while taking them to task with process-oriented talk.

Save your breath, Coach. The cat's already out of the bag.

Stop by any book store and on the racks you'll find a bevy of college football preview magazines touting the wealth of riches at Saban's disposal this season. From Athlon to Phil Steele and every one in between, the periodicals all have one thing in common: They like the Tide in 2011. Alabama is slotted no lower than third in any major magazine's preseason poll.

"Alabama will dominate on defense," Phil Steele said. "I have them rated as the best defense in the country. They have 10 starters back. They've got my No. 1-rated linebacker group, No. 1-rated defensive back group and No. 4 defensive line. When your weakness is my fourth-ranked defensive line ... I don't think I've ever said that before."
